Shell Sort - Implementation Improvements

This section provides a tutorial on how to improve the performance of the Shell Sort implementation by using different step sizes.

You can try to improve the performance on my implementation of the Shell Sort algorithm by using different step sizes.

Last update: 2011.

Table of Contents

 About This Book

 Introduction of Sorting Algorithms

 Java API for Sorting Algorithms

 Insertion Sort Algorithm and Implementation

 Selection Sort Algorithm and Implementation

 Bubble Sort Algorithm and Implementation

 Quicksort Algorithm and Implementation

 Merge Sort Algorithm and Implementation

 Heap Sort Algorithm and Implementation

Shell Sort Algorithm and Implementation

 Shell Sort - Algorithm Introduction

 Shell Sort - Java Implementation

 Shell Sort - Performance

Shell Sort - Implementation Improvements

 Performance Summary of Java Implementations

 References

 PDF Printing Version